Abstract (EN)
In this paper, we present a multiagent model in which agents have a perception upon their shared environment, a measure is associated to the agents’ perception field. We apply the model on the Vehicle Routing Problem with Time Windows (VRPTW). The overall process adopts the general schema of parallel insertion meth- ods and it uses the contracting of perception’s field of the vehicle agents as a new distance between them. This new measure expresses the feasibility universe of the vehicles and is used as a criterion of choice between candidates vehicles for the insertion of a customer in their plan. Our approach provides a new method to tackle the Time constrained VRP in which the solving process is focused on the fu- ture and constitutes an alternative for handling the dynamic version of the problem.
